Our children’s services have been rated outstanding in all areas!
Newham’s Children’s Services are officially ‘outstanding’ across all areas, according to the latest Ofsted report. Inspectors found children in need of help and protection, those in care and those who are care leavers receive excellent support and benefit from very stable relationships with their workers who know them extremely well. The judgement shows an ‘outstanding’ rating across all four areas: ‘the impact of leaders on social work practice with children and families’; ‘the experiences and progress of children who need help and protection’; ‘the experiences and progress of children in care’; ‘the experiences and progress of care leavers’, as well as ‘overall effectiveness’.

Why you should work for us
Newham is a great place to be a social worker. It’s an incredibly diverse borough with a young population and is experiencing considerable regeneration as part of the Olympic legacy. Newham presents challenges and opportunities that will help to take your career to the next level.
Social workers are at the core of our work with children and families. Our approach is about enabling social workers to build relationships with children, young people and their carers in order to deliver real, meaningful change for children.
We’ve worked hard to make Newham a great place to be a Social Worker with a commitment to addressing disproportionality wherever we find it- we are signed up tothe Social Care Workforce Race Equality Standard and the CYPS directorate are actively leading in the Tackling Racism, Inequality and Disproportionately (TRID) Steering Group.
